Part Overview

The BQ2002SNTR is a multi-chemistry battery charger IC manufactured by Texas Instruments, classified as a Power Management (PMIC) component. This 8-SOIC surface mount device provides constant and pulsed charging control with programmable voltage features for battery pack applications up to 2V. The part is currently in active production status with full RoHS3 compliance and unlimited moisture sensitivity rating (MSL 1). Key Parameters

Parameter Value
Manufacturer Texas Instruments
Category Power Management (PMIC)
Battery Chemistry Multi-Chemistry
Current - Charging Constant, Pulsed
Programmable Features Voltage
Battery Pack Voltage 2V
Voltage - Supply (Max) 6V
Operating Temperature 0°C ~ 70°C (TA)
Mounting Type Surface Mount
Package / Case 8-SOIC (0.154", 3.90mm Width)
RoHS Status ROHS3 Compliant
Moisture Sensitivity Level (MSL) 1 (Unlimited)
Product Status Active

Engineering Selection Recommendations

All three parts—BQ2002SNTR, BQ2002CSNTR, and BQ2002TSNTR—are active production components from Texas Instruments with identical electrical and mechanical specifications. Selection between these variants is based on packaging and inventory availability rather than functional differences. The BQ2002SNTR and BQ2002TSNTR are supplied in Tape & Reel (TR) packaging, suitable for automated assembly processes. The BQ2002CSNTR does not specify packaging format in the provided data. All parts maintain full RoHS3 compliance and REACH unaffected status, meeting regulatory requirements for industrial and consumer applications. MSL 1 rating indicates unlimited shelf life under standard storage conditions. Component selection should prioritize availability and packaging requirements for the target manufacturing process.
